The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Staffordshire with a requirement for Internet sk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Internet over the 6 months to 10 June 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
10 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 86 62 61
Rank change year-on-year -24 -1 -11
Permanent jobs citing Internet 11 2 10
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Staffordshire 0.93% 0.38% 1.51%
As % of the Communications & Networking category 6.79% 1.49% 7.30%
Number of salaries quoted 5 2 10
10th Percentile - - £22,750
25th Percentile £16,251 £31,250 £36,563
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£26,500 £32,500 £41,500
Median % change year-on-year -18.46% -21.69% +27.69%
75th Percentile £27,250 £33,750 £48,259
90th Percentile £40,900 - £57,000
West Midlands median annual salary £35,000 £35,000 £45,000
% change year-on-year - -22.22% +12.50%
